
BLACKPINK's Rosé revealed the struggles she experienced while preparing her first studio album 'rosie.' On the 4th (local time), through an interview with the American fashion magazine 'PAPER,' Rosé talked about episodes related to the production of her first studio album 'rosie.' This full album is her first since her solo contract with YG ENTERTAINMENT ended last December. After BLACKPINK's last performance of the world tour 'BORN PINK' held at the Seoul Gocheok Sky Dome in September last year, the members have been pursuing solo activities. She stated, 'This full album was a battle with myself,' and added, 'In the early stages of album production, there was a lot of expectation and anxiety, but after letting my friends listen to the completed music, I gained strength thanks to their support.' Rosé completed the album through collaborations with various artists and producers, releasing the single 'APT.' as a pre-release track in collaboration with Bruno Mars. Bruno Mars mentioned about Rosé's song, 'APT. is interesting. Thanks to her, the song is gaining popularity at a fast pace.' 'APT.' is a unique number inspired by a game played at Korean drinking parties, and it has gained immense popularity right after its release. With this song, she achieved the highest ranking ever for a Korean female solo artist at 8th place on the US Billboard 'HOT 100,' and maintained the number one position on the 'Billboard Global' chart for two consecutive weeks. Additionally, she recorded 2nd place on the UK Official Singles Chart 'TOP 100,' setting a new record for K-POP female artists. Recently, despite her busy schedule, she expressed that she is 'incredibly happy' and introduced the theme of her new album. Rosé wanted to convey more honest and personal stories to her fans, explaining the album's theme as 'the confusion of my twenties.' In particular, some of the tracks address malicious comments and online defamation, honestly expressing her struggles that she had not shared with fans before, stating, 'I wanted to clarify the misunderstandings surrounding me and show my true self.' She added, 'I hope the new album will have special meaning for both me and my fans.' She also mentioned that she still frequently communicates with the other BLACKPINK members, revealing that Lisa encouraged her by saying, 'Make a lot of songs,' which became a great source of strength for her.
